Ao executar o comando abaixo ocorreu o erro:
CREATE TABLE inscricoes_evento ( id INT AUTOINCREMENT PRIMARY KEY, nome VARCHAR(100) NOT NULL, email VARCHAR(100) NOT NULL, telefone VARCHAR(20) DEFAULT 'Não fornecido' );
Você está vendo a versão anterior da nova experiência da Alura que estamos preparando para você. Em breve, ela ganha uma identidade visual novinha totalmente pensada em potencializar seus estudos!
Ao executar o comando abaixo ocorreu o erro:
CREATE TABLE inscricoes_evento ( id INT AUTOINCREMENT PRIMARY KEY, nome VARCHAR(100) NOT NULL, email VARCHAR(100) NOT NULL, telefone VARCHAR(20) DEFAULT 'Não fornecido' );
Bom dia Emerson,
a sintaxe do comando é um pouco diferente. A palavra chave para auto incremento é "IDENTITY". O (1,1) significa que o campo será preenchido a partir de 1, com auto incremento de 1 para cada novo registro. Vide abaixo:
CREATE TABLE inscricoes_evento (
id INT IDENTITY(1,1) PRIMARY KEY,
nome VARCHAR(100) NOT NULL,
email VARCHAR(100) NOT NULL,
telefone VARCHAR(20) DEFAULT 'Não fornecido' );